	As some of you who run anoncvs servers know, this is the
machine many of you will fan out from, recieving source updates from
me and then passing them on. people running anoncvs servers can
do this via sup or cvsync as outlined in the anoncvs.shar file. 

	One of the things I am missing complete info on was my list
of fanout servers. Please check your anoncvs server if you run one, and
attempt to update. If you can not connect to the machine, please let me
know, including the details of what server you are running, and what
IP address it is connecting to me from.
